POT 10 – Beginning Wheel (Berman)
Callanwolde Fine Arts Center 980 Briarcliff Rd NE, Atlanta, GA, United StatesArt ClassesThis is the perfect entry level class for beginning wheel students. It will cover the basic techniques of throwing, glazing, and firing. Students will also learn the important safety guidelines and procedures of the ceramics studio. Projects on the wheel will focus on small forms (cups, bowls, saucers).

POT 03 – Beginning Handbuilding (Yoganathan)
Callanwolde Fine Arts Center 980 Briarcliff Rd NE, Atlanta, GA, United StatesArt ClassesHandbuilding is the art of making ceramic forms without the use of a potter's wheel. Students will study the basics of building pots by pinch, coil, and/or slab built techniques, and learn the important safety guidelines and procedures of ceramics studio. POT 18 – Intermediate Level 2 – Wheel (Soda Firing) (Berman)
Callanwolde Fine Arts Center 980 Briarcliff Rd NE, Atlanta, GA, United StatesArt ClassesIntermediate wheel classes focus on the process of soda firings. Students will learn about the effects of introducing these sodium compounds into a gas fired kiln, and the many variables that can happen on pottery when it is fired this way. JWY 02 – Beginning/Intermediate Jewelry & Metalsmithing (Mujtaba)
Callanwolde Fine Arts Center 980 Briarcliff Rd NE, Atlanta, GA, United StatesArt ClassesBeginner students will learn traditional metalsmithing techniques like piercing, soldering, forming, texturing and bezel setting to create jewelry of their own design or an assigned project. Intermediate students are self-directed but can explore more precision-based techniques such as prong setting, chain making, forging, and hollow construction.
